17 December 2020
New agreements were announced today with to buy doses off drug companies AstraZeneca and Novavax.
Pre-existing deals with Pfizer and Janssen means there's now 15-million courses heading our way.
Frontline workers could be immunised as early as April - while the others may be vaccinated from July.
Health Minister Andrew Little says they'll be reaching out to Maori and Pacific health providers.
He says it's important making sure population groups which don't enjoy the best access to health services are covered too.
